Transaction 3eaf2a7e0f9a3e28deb790357c6b6a7094e4df450e3194eb490678479c367202
1 Input
1 Output
-
3eaf2a7e0f9a3e28deb790357c6b6a7094e4df450e3194eb490678479c367202:0
- value
- 2007380
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 707b5790946a91ab3a72bc28f84e6850733a660f OP_EQUAL
- address
- 3BwmMz4Y8TRH3BUeAmX4d8YuBZJVRT6obR